Art rock gets a 21st century boost in Dagmar's rolling story about a guy who can't get out of bed in the morning and an insect goddess who plunges through the ether to rescue him. The first in what will be a 3-part, 3-CD song cycle.

Hailing from the Greenpoint neighborhood of Brooklyn, NY and Boston, MA, six piece DAGMAR is fronted by creator/singer/guitarist JIM BAUER and diva MEGHAN McGEARY, whose vocal range and mercurial stage presence literally transfix audiences. They are joined by a rare collection of virtuoso musicians: Mat Fieldes on electric bass, Vessko Gellev on violin, Pablo Rieppi on percussion & vibes, and David Rozenblatt on drums and marimba.

Bauer and McGeary also tour as a duo, DAGMAR 2, featuring Jim on vocals & guitar and Meghan on vocals, assorted percussion, melodica, costumes and drama.

For their contribution to this political season, Dagmar 2 released a music video of their new protest song "(TO HELL WITH) THE COMMANDER-IN-CHIEF" which was honored on You Tube video in the TOP 100 MUSIC VIDEOS in its first week and is currently ranked #2 in the TOP 100 PROTEST VIDEOS on Neil Young's Living With War page (http://www.neilyoung.com/lwwtoday/lwwvideospage.html). Dagmar 2 also recorded another new protest song "GIVE ME THE RIFLE" which is ranked #14 on Neil Young's TOP 700 SONGS OF THE TIMES list (http://www.neilyoung.com/lwwtoday/lwwsongspage.html).

Dagmar has played to SRO audiences in the top small music venues in New York and Boston since its debut at Joe’s Pub (NYC) in June 2005. It will begin a European tour in July 2007 at Etnafest in Catania, Sicily (http://www.etnafest.it).

Dagmar's live performances have been compared to The Flaming Lips, the B52s, and early Genesis. McGeary's stage presence has been likened to Nina Hagen, Kate Bush, Siouxie Sioux, Annie Lennox, Patti Smith and Cyndi Lauper, with Bauer's music and charismatic performance drawing comparisons to moody songwriters Leonard Cohen, Morrissey, Elvis Costello and Richard Thompson.
